在网络工具的众多解决方案中,v2ray 是一种广泛使用的代理工具,因其优秀的性能和高度的可配置性倍受用户青睐。然而,有时用户在使用 v2ray 进行配置或操作时可能会遇到“启动失败超过2秒”的问题。这对于那些需要稳定、迅速的网络工具的用户来说,无疑是一个操作上的困扰。本文将深入探讨该问题的根本原因以及可能的解决方案。
v2ray启动失败超过2秒的常见原因
1. 配置文件错误
- 错误的配置文件路径
- 无效的 JSON 格式
- 不支持的或过期的端口设置
一旦配置文件中的内容不准确,v2ray 在启动过程中就会遭遇障碍,最终导致启动失败。
2. 端口冲突
- 多个应用监听相同端口
- 网络防火墙设置阻止访问
端口是网络通信的重要组成部分,如果 v2ray 所用端口被其他应用占用,或是网络安全设置造成了访问限制,最会导致启动失败。
3. 系统资源不足
- 内存不足
- CPU 占用过高
- 硬盘空间不足
在服务器或计算机上资源紧张时,v2ray 可能无法顺利完成启动,尤其是在请求量极大的情况下,更容易加剧此问题的出现。
4. 软件版本问题
- 使用过期或不兼容的版本
- 更新失败造成的版本不匹配
不断更新的软件能够修复已知问题和优化性能,如果用户运行的软件版本过时,就可能在启动时遇到块。
5. 外部网络问题
- DNS 未能解析
- 临时的网络不畅
v2ray 依赖于稳定的网络连接,外部网络的问题也可能会影响到 v2ray 的启动。
如何解决v2ray启动失败超过2秒的问题
1. 检查配置文件
- 确保路径指向正确
- 使用 JSON 验证工具检查文件格式
- 确认端口设置符合要求
在启动 v2ray 之前,一定要细致检查配置文件,查找潜在的问题。
2. 修改端口设置
- 使用
lsof -i :<port>
命令检查端口占用 - 如果存在冲突,请选择一个未被占用的端口
可以手动更改连接的端口,确保面临的冲突得以解决。
3. 优化系统资源
- 关闭其他不必要的应用程序
- 检查系统资源占用,必要时进行升级
合理分配计算机资源有助于提高 v2ray 启动速度。
4. 更新软件版本
- 访问 v2ray 的官方网站以确定最新版本
- 后备重要数据,再执行更新操作
更新 v2ray 至最新版本可以有效降低软件出错几率。
5. 排查外部网络问题
- 使用
ping
命令检查外部连接质量 - 试着切换 DNS 可改善解析问题
确保网络重启和DNS正常,可以提升 v2ray 的启动效率并规避一些不必要的麻烦。
FAQ:v2ray启动失败超过2秒常见问题
Q1: 如何检测v2ray的版本是否过时?
答:在命令行输入 v2ray -version
查询当前的版本信息,可以与官方网站上的最新版本进行比较。
Q2: 程序崩溃后如何重新启动v2ray?
答:推荐通过命令行终端执行 ./v2ray run
;如真相程序崩溃,请务必查阅日志进行故障排除。
Q3: 使用过程中可能遇到哪些其他问题?
答:经常遇到的问题包括配置错误、断链、速度不佳等,当然利用详细文档能起到很大帮助。
Q4: 如何优化我的网络环境?
答:建议采用具有稳定性且低延迟的网络环境,并尽量避免在高峰期进行关键操作。
Q5: 什么是v2ray的最基本配置值得注意的内容?
答:最基本的配置包括确保 server、address、port 等关键内容无误,并检验入站与出站的配置逻辑是否绝对匹配。
通过以上内容,我们全面阐释了*“v2ray启动失败超过2秒”*所涉及的多种因由,希望能够帮到浏览本文章的每位用户。确保遵循相关步骤,将能够有效解决您在使用 v2ray 过程中所遇到的困难。
希望每位使用者都能轻松愉悦地使用 v2ray!